fullscreenerror Olayı
Tanım ve Kullanım
fullscreenerror olayı, elementin tam ekran modunda görüntülenememesi durumunda, hatta talep edilmiş olsa bile, gerçekleşir.
Açıklama:Bu olay, farklı tarayıcılar arasında çalışmak için belirli bir ön ekle gerektirir (aşağıdaki daha fazla örnek bkz.).
Uyarı:Kullanın element.requestFullscreen() yöntemi elementi tam ekran modunda görüntülemek için.
Uyarı:Kullanın element.exitFullscreen() Tam ekran modunu iptal etme yöntemi.
Örnek
Eğer element tam ekran modunda görüntülenemiyorsa, bazı metinler gösterilir:
document.addEventListener("fullscreenerror", function() {
alert("Fullscreen denied")
});
Sözdizimi
HTML'de:
<element onfullscreenerror="myScript">
JavaScript'te:
nesne.onfullscreenerror = function(){myScript});
JavaScript'te addEventListener() metodu kullanarak:
nesne.addEventListener("fullscreenerror", myScript);
Açıklama:Internet Explorer 8 veya daha eski sürümler desteklememektedir addEventListener() Metodu.
Teknik Detaylar
| Yayılır: | Desteği Var |
|---|---|
| İptal Edilebilir: | Desteklenmiyor |
| Olay Türü: | Event |
| Desteği olan HTML Etiketleri: | Tüm HTML Elemanları |
Tarayıcı Desteği
Tabloda, bu olayı tamamen destekleyen ilk tarayıcı sürüm numaraları belirtilmiştir. Açıklama: Her tarayıcı belirli bir ön ekle gerektirir (dış parantezlerde bkz.):
| Olay | Chrome | IE | Firefox | Safari | Opera |
|---|---|---|---|---|---|
| fullscreenerror | 45.0 (webkit) | 11.0 (ms) | 47.0 (moz) | 5.1 (webkit) | 15.0 (webkit) |
Örnek
Çoklu tarayıcı kodu için ön ekler:
/* Standart dilim */
document.addEventListener("fullscreenerror", function() {
...
});
/* Firefox */
document.addEventListener("mozfullscreenerror", function() {
...
});
/* Chrome, Safari ve Opera */
document.addEventListener("webkitfullscreenerror", function() {
...
});
/* IE / Edge */
document.addEventListener("msfullscreenerror", function() {
...
});

